Trip Report - Blackpool Bash 2010
The first coaster trip of the year is the clubs social event of the year, The legendary Blackpool Bash where members travelled from all over the UK in great weather and converged on the seaside town of Blackpool. Carnesky's Ghost Train had opened up especially for us so this weekend so a few of us started the weekend having a go. The Bash kicked off at 8PM in The Paradise Room when Andy opened the events with a few jokes followed by the tradition of getting Graham & Colleen on stage to take part in a dangerous stunt. This year Graham's hand was forced down onto a number of cups, underneath one of them was a sharp spike which he needed to avoid.
Up early on Saturday it was back to The Pleasure Beach. We were taken in the park via the side gate, some eager members had queued up at the main entrance expecting to get in first not realising we went into the park via the side gate before! We all went over to the Big One for our first ERS of the day, a dual ERS on The Big One & The Steeplechase. After the ERS's had finished members split up into their respective groups for some more riding. Lunch was provided in The Paradise Room where we could all view and purchase the clubs' latest merchandise including the new T-Shirt with the new club logo. Last year a lot of members got absolutely soaked in the new fountain attraction, one year on the public were not allowed in the fountain area during the shows, at least many members stayed dry! At 4PM The Grand National was closed to the public for our exclusive ride session. The park closed at 6PM giving us plenty of time to return to our hotels for a short time before the night time events and Coaster Crazy Show.
At 8PM everyone gathered in The Paradise Room for The Toga Party Themed Coaster Crazy Show. The show opened with Andy, Alan & Wendy dressed in Roman attire followed by Andy introducing the night ahead. Gary Williams was the first main act of the night performing "Shine" and this was followed by Ryan dressed up as one of the guys from the "Go Compare" advert, This led us into the first game of the night entitled Knockout where members came up onto stage and played the "Yes/No" game where they had to try and survive for a minute without saying "Yes" or "No" The top 3 winners were to progress to part 2 of the game later in the show. Next up was Libby Williams who performed "Diamonds Are A Girl's Best Friend".
This was followed by our second game of the evening, the popular Kids Gopher Game where the kids are asked to retrieve an item from the audience.
